English: Benefit Metal Decoction
Also Known As: Metal Pearls
Pharmaceutical Latin
Pin Yin
Dosage
Actions
Bul. Lilii Bai He 9-30g Nourishes Stomach Yin, harmonizes the Middle Jiao, moistens the Lungs, clears Heat, stops coughing, clears the Heart and calms the Spirit.
With Hua Shi, for dark urine and dysuria.
Rz. Belamcandae She Gan 3-10g Clears Heat, relieves Fire toxicity, transforms Phlegm and clears the Lungs.
With Huang Qin, for a sore throat and coughing due to Lung Heat.
With Huang Qin and Jie Geng, for pain and swelling of the throat with hoarseness due to Fire Excess.
With Xing Ren and Jie Geng, for coughing, pain and swelling of the throat with difficulty expectorating due to Lung Heat.
Rx. Platycodi Jie Geng 3-10g Opens the Lungs, spreads Lung Qi and expels Phlegm.
With Zhi Ban Xia, for coughing due to Wind-Cold Invasion or long-standing Phlegm-Dampness.
Sm. Armeniacae Xing Ren 3-10g Stops cough, calms wheezing, moistens the Intestines and unblocks bowels.
Rz. Pinelliae Preparatum Zhi Ban Xia 3-15g Dries Dampness, transforms Phlegm, descends Rebellious Qi harmonizes the Stomach and stops vomiting.
With Chen Pi, for epigastric and abdominal distention or pain due to disharmony of the Stomach Qi and a productive cough and a stifling sensation in the chest due to Phlegm-Damp Obstruction or Spleen Qi Deficiency.
With Fu Ling, expels Phlegm and stops nausea and vomiting, hiccups, coughs with clear, profuse Phlegm and loose and watery stools and prevents turbid Phlegm and Dampness from disturbing the Heart with dizziness, palpitations and insomnia.
With Huang Qin, for Phlegm-Heat induced Rebellious Qi with cough, nausea, and vomiting.
Poria Fu Ling 9-18g Promotes urination, leaches out Dampness, strengthens the Spleen and harmonizes the Middle Jiao.
With Zhi Ban Xia and Chen Pi, for nausea, vomiting, chest fullness and distention and anorexia due to congested fluids.
Per. Citri Reticulatae Chen Pi 3-9g Regulates and descends Qi, adjusts the Middle, relieves the diaphragm, dries Dampness and transforms Phlegm.
With Fu Ling and Zhi Ban Xia, for coughing due to accumulation of Dampness and Phlegm.
Rx. Scutellariae Huang Qin 3-18g Clears Heat, cools the Blood, dries Dampness, drains Fire, detoxifies and calms ascending Liver Yang.
With Bai Shao, for dysenteric disorders with abdominal pain due to Heat entering the Interior.
Rx. Paeoniae alba Bai Shao 5-30g Nourishes the Blood, astringes Yin, adjusts the Ying and Wei, calms Liver Yang and Liver Wind and alleviates pain.
Talcum Hua Shi 9-18g Expels Damp-Heat, releases Summeheat and resolves Dampness.
Bombyx Batryticatus Jiang Can 3-10g Dispels Wind, disperses Wind-Heat, stops itching and pain, transforms Phlegm, softens hardness, eliminates toxins and dissipates nodules.
